2013-03-18 2 views
-2

Я пытаюсь добавить валюту из нескольких строк. Ниже приведен мой код. Я не знаю, где должен быть SUM.PHP Добавить валюту в таблицу

Я также хотел бы представить таблицу результатов в формате PDF с использованием FPDF, если это возможно. Я пробовал вставлять свой код, но не мог заставить его работать, продолжал давать мне ошибку, что он не в правильном формате. Я продолжал бить CTRL + k и вводил код, но он не работал;

Любые советы?

<?php 
session_start(); // start up your PHP session! 
?> 
<html> 
<head> 
    <meta charset="UTF-8"/> 
    <title>Accounting Page</title> 
    <link rel="stylesheet" type="text/css" href="../css/table.css"/> 
    <script src="../js/table.js" type="text/javascript"></script> 
</head> 
<?php 
error_reporting(0); 
$con = mysql_connect("localhost", "root", "rq5f4mkn"); 
if (!$con) { 
    die('Could not connect: ' . mysql_error()); 
} 
mysql_select_db("charitabledb", $con); 
$sql = "SELECT * FROM accounting"; 

$result = mysql_query($sql); 
?> 
<div id="content"> 
    <div id="blog"> 
     <div id="articles" style="width:692px;padding:0;"> 
      <table width="250" border="1" class="example table-autosort table-autofilter 
     table-autopage:10 table-stripeclass:alternate table-page-number:t1page table- 
     page-count:t1pages table-filtered-rowcount:t1filtercount table- 
     rowcount:t1allcount" id="t1"> 
       <thead> 
       <tr style="height:35px"> 
        <th class="table-filterable table-sortable:default table-sortable" title="Click 
      to sort">Date 
        </th> 
        <th class="table-filterable table-sortable:default table-sortable" 
         title="Click to sort">Transaction Type 
        </th> 
        <th class="table-filterable table-sortable:default table-sortable" 
         title="Click to sort">Account 
        </th> 
        <th class="table-filterable table-sortable:default table-sortable" 
         title="Click to sort">Description 
        </th> 
        <th class="table-filterable table-sortable:default table-sortable" 
         title="Click to sort">Amount 
        </th> 
       </tr> 
       </thead> 
       <tbody> 
       <?php 
       while($row = mysql_fetch_array($result)) 
       { 
       ?> 
       <tr> 
        <td><?php echo $row['date']?></td> 
        <td><?php echo $row['transactiontype']?></td> 
        <td><?php echo $row['account']?></td> 
        <td><?php echo $row['description']?></td> 
        <td><?php echo $row['amount']?></td> 

        <?php 
        } 
        mysql_close($con); 
        ?> 
       </tbody> 
       <tfoot> 

       <tr> 
        <td style="cursor:pointer;" 
         class="table- page:previous">&lt; &lt;Previous 
        </td> 

        <td style="text-align:center;" colspan="1">Page <span id="t1page">1</span>&nbsp;of 
         <span id="t1pages">11</span></td> 
        <td style="cursor:pointer;" class="table-page:next">Next &gt; &gt;</td> 
       </tr> 
       <tr> 
        <td colspan="3"><span id="t1filtercount">105</span>&nbsp;of 
         <span id="t1allcount">105</span>&nbsp;rows match filter(s) 
        </td> 
       </tr> 
       </tfoot> 
      </table> 
+0

Добро пожаловать на борт. Поскольку вы новичок, я предлагаю несколько указателей, а не downvoting. Начните с обмена своим кодом и объясните, что вы уже пробовали :) – BenM

+0

Прочтите праймер Markdown: http://stackoverflow.com/editing-help – deceze

+0

* Вот мой код до сих пор * Добро пожаловать в переполнение стека. Похоже, вы забыли включить код :) Также лучше не комбинировать разрозненные вопросы в одном потоке. Вы должны открыть новый вопрос об экспорте в pdf. – Leigh

ответ

0

Если вы просто сложением всех значений в таблице:

mysql_query("SELECT SUM(amount) FROM accounting"); 
+0

Хорошо, спасибо, где бы я положил заявление? –

+0

Если вы добавите * селектор в оператор, вы можете заменить существующий. – advermark

+0

Это не работает, к сожалению, таблица не придумывает суммы, которые были добавлены вместе. –

Смежные вопросы